Sport

No drinking allowed at the Olympics no one wants

Earlier this week, organizers from the Tokyo Olympic committee were considering allowing alcohol sales at Olympic events. But, like many things the Olympic committee has done, they were met with immediate backlash from Japanese citizens.

Read more…